Is mental health literacy related to different types of coping? Comparing adolescents, young-adults and adults correlates

Introduction: Mental health literacy is associated with better mental outcomes and believed to improve the way people cope life challenges manage issues. Nevertheless, no study has yet empirically examined relationships between use of coping strategies. Aims: This aims describe levels (literacy about illness positive health) (coping styles) in adolescents, young-adults adults; To explore relationship each age group; compare if patterns significant correlations vary across groups. Methods: a cross-sectional / exploratory design study. We have collected online through paper-pencil method three developmental samples: adolescents aged 15-18 years old (N=240), 19-36 (74) adults 37-75 (N=105). Measures used were: Positive Health Questionnaire PosMHLitq (Maia de Carvalho et al., preparation) evaluate health; Literacy MHLq (Campos 2016; Dias 2018) Portuguese adaptation Brief Cope by Pais Ribeiro Tavares (2004) control styles. Results: Across groups, most styles are both well-being, but different correlation coping/literacy well-being/coping/literacy The Use Emotional Support only style significantly well-being adults. Conclusions: Future research should examine this findings longitudinal design.
